Downer Wine and Spirits rocks. It is, without a doubt, true that they don’t have the biggest selection; the place is ridiculously cramped. The reason you come here is because 1) It’s on Downder Ave. and you like being there; 2) The small but well selected beer (and wine); and 3) Especially the knowledgeable staff. The workers/owners here always steer me to good drinks, and it’s just fun talking to them about beer and wine. It’s a treat to visit.

Dingy liquor store on Milwaukee’s east side. Pretty cramped quarters with one whole wall dedicated to beer, mostly decent stuff. Bells, Victory, Founders, Allagash, etc. I was happy to find one lone bottle of Bells Batch 8000 and that made the trip worth it. Some domestics available as singles though you have to ask for prices on lots of them. Belgian 750s and domestic bombers share the coolers with six packs. Service was friendly and answered my pricing questions.

Since Murray’s closed, Northside Milwaukee has been in serious need of a worthy successor... Unfortunately, Downer Wine & Spirits isn’t it. I had heard good things by word-of-mouth, but something about this place left me slightly underwhelmed. Located across from the Sendik’s on Downer, this small shop manages to stock quite a few beers, in the little space available (much of the space is devoted to wine an spirits). There are about 8 cooler doors worth of craft six-packs and large singles, and a very small shelf for mix-and-match singles, plus a few 12-packs stacked in the aisles. The selection was pretty good, and I did find Lagunitas’s Lumpy Gravy (which I hadn’t seen anywhere else up to that point), but the selection was far from exemplary. In addition, I just didn’t get the feeling that this place would stock something new the minute it came out, the way that Murray’s did. So, although Downer Spirits offers some nice beers, it certainly isn’t a destination to travel to.
